Output ef9ba42f54e887c9743c10e858d6517c1140c5b54a8ff26fc9af6110b655c8b7:2

value
3143556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3d1b9877d6fd4bc9218f87bfae4b3be7becb152 OP_EQUAL
address
3KYQvszQEYzt89NMvsDDSTTh6YyixTKjxZ
transaction
ef9ba42f54e887c9743c10e858d6517c1140c5b54a8ff26fc9af6110b655c8b7
spent
true